[PATCH] tests/docker: avoid invalid escape in Python string

This is an error in Python 3.12; fix it by using a raw string literal.

diff --git a/tests/docker/docker.py b/tests/docker/docker.py
index 688ef62989c..3b8a26704df 100755
--- a/tests/docker/docker.py
+++ b/tests/docker/docker.py
@@ -186,7 +186,7 @@ def _check_binfmt_misc(executable):
(binary))
return None, True
- m = re.search("interpreter (\S+)\n", entry)
+ m = re.search(r"interpreter (\S+)\n", entry)
interp = m.group(1)
if interp and interp != executable:
print("binfmt_misc for %s does not point to %s, using %s" %
